An opportunity to join AP Racing’s Specialty OE team in a commercially driven, customer-facing role focused on winning new business and driving growth across key OEM accounts. You will be responsible for identifying, developing, and securing new programme opportunities with both existing and target customers. Working at the front end of vehicle development cycles, you will position AP Racing as the preferred partner for high-performance braking and clutch systems. This role requires a strong blend of technical credibility and commercial drive, with clear accountability for delivering new programme wins and contributing directly to Specialty OE revenue growth targets.
Key Responsibilities
- Identify and develop new business opportunities across Specialty OE customers
- Engage OEMs early to influence specification and secure programme positions
- Lead RFQs and proposals through to successful award
- Build, own, and convert a strong opportunity pipeline into programme wins
- Develop senior customer relationships to support long term growth
- Influence internal teams to align behind key opportunities
Competencies and Experience
- Proven track record in winning new business or securing programmes
- Strong commercial mindset with ability to drive revenue growth
- Resilient and persistent in long, complex sales cycles
- Able to influence both customers and internal stakeholders
- Technically credible with engineering understanding
- Comfortable operating in a fast paced, high pressure OEM environment
Success in Role
- New programme nominations secured
- Growth in Specialty OE revenue
- Expansion of AP Racing position within key OEM customers
- Strong and active opportunity pipeline
Preferred Experience
- Experience within an OE automotive or motorsport supplier environment, with involvement in customer engagement, RFQs, or securing new business.
